1. It is the potential for harm, or adverse effect on an employee‘s health. a. .Chemicals b. Exposure c. Risk d.
Hazard
2. It is the likelihood that a hazard will cause injury or ill health to anyone at or near a workplace. a. Risk b.
Exposure c. Hazard d. .Chemicals
3. This occurs when a person comes into contact with a hazard.
a. Risk b. Exposure c.. Hazard d. . Chemicals
4. This includes floors, stairs, work platforms, steps, ladders, fire, falling objects, slippery surfaces, manual
handling (lifting, pushing, pulling), excessively loud and prolonged noise, vibration, heat and cold, radiation,
poor lighting, ventilation, air quality.
a. Chemicals b. Mechanical and/or electrical c. Psychosocial environment d. Physical
5. It includes electricity, machinery, equipment, pressure vessels, dangerous goods, fork lifts, cranes, hoists. a.
Mechanical and/or electrical b. Chemicals c. Biological d. Psychosocial environment
6. It includes chemical substances such as acids or poisons and those that could lead to fire or explosion, like
pesticides, herbicides, cleaning agents, dusts and fumes from various processes such as welding.
a. Chemicals b. Psychosocial environment c. Mechanical and/or electrical d. Biological
7. It includes bacteria, viruses, mold, mildew, insects, vermin, animals
a. Biological b. Chemicals c. Mechanical and/or electrical d. Psychosocial environment
8. It includes workplace stressors arising from a variety of sources.
a. Psychosocial environment b. Biological c. .Chemicals d. Mechanical and/or electrical
9. It the physical or environmental conditions of work which comply with the prescribed Occupational Health
Safety (OHS) standards and which allow the workers to perform his or her job without or within acceptable
exposure to hazards. a. Safety b. Biological c. Psychosocial environment d. Chemicals
10. The practices related to production and work process are referred to as ______. a. occupational safety b.
safety c. psychosocial environment d. biological
